Colne Road is in Barnoldswick and in Pendle district. BB18 5QH is located in the Barnoldswick elect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Pendle. This postcode has been in use since 1997-12-01.

Safety

Is Colne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Colne Road was 18.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 75.6% lower than the Barnoldswick average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Colne Road has the 2nd lowest crime rate of 39 local areas in Barnoldswick and the 16th lowest crime rate of 298 local areas in Pendle .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 6.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-10.8%.
